site stats

Merge algorithm in c

WebWorking of Merge sort Algorithm. Now, let's see the working of merge sort Algorithm. To understand the working of the merge sort algorithm, let's take an unsorted array. It will … Web9 mrt. 2014 · Program for Merge Sort in C. Merge sort runs in O (n log n) running time. It is a very efficient sorting data structure algorithm with near optimal number of …

How do I write a program for merge sort in C? • GITNUX

Web13 apr. 2024 · Top 10 Sorting Algorithms You Need to Know Bubble sort Insertion sort Quicksort Bucket sort Shell sort Merge sort Selection sort Radix sort Comb sort Timsort All Sorting Algorithms Compared... Web5 apr. 2024 · Merge sort is one of the most powerful sorting algorithms. Merge sort is widely used in various applications as well. The best part about these algorithms is that … igned by me. lets play csgo : https://matchstick-inc.com

Merge Sort (With Code in Python/C++/Java/C) - Programiz

Web13 apr. 2024 · Comparison-based sorting algorithms. These compare elements of the data set and determine their order based on the result of the comparison. Examples of … Web28 mrt. 2024 · There are multiple ways to concatenate two strings in C language: Without Using strcat () function Using standard method Using function Using recursion Using … WebI am trying to implement the merge sort algorithm in C. I understand how the algorithm is supposed to work however I am encountering some difficulties with the implementation. I … igneo france isbergues

Merge Sort In C C Program For Merge Sort Edureka

Category:C Program for Merge Sort - GeeksforGeeks

Tags:Merge algorithm in c

Merge algorithm in c

Merge Sort in C – Algorithm and Program With …

Web4 jan. 2024 · The basic steps of a merge sort algorithm are as follows: If the array is of length 0 or 1, then it is already sorted. Otherwise, divide the unsorted array into two sub … Web12 dec. 2015 · Merge Sort Technique was designed by Jon Von Neumann in 1945. The objective of this algorithm is to merge Two already Sorted Lists and combine them in a Single Sorted List. The Merge Sort Algorithm works on Divide and Conquer Algorithm where a given problem is divided into smaller subdivisions.

Merge algorithm in c

Did you know?

Web24 mrt. 2024 · How to merge to arrays in C language - Take two arrays as input and try to merge or concatenate two arrays and store the result in third array.The logic to merge … Web23 mrt. 2024 · Algorithm: Step 1: Start Step 2: Declare an array and left, right, mid variable Step 3: Perform merge function. mergesort (array,left,right) mergesort (array, left, right) if …

Web12 jan. 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Web29 mrt. 2024 · Merge sort is one of the efficient & fastest sorting algorithms with the following time complexity: Worst Case Time Complexity: O (n*log n) Best Case Time …

Web31 mrt. 2024 · Algorithm: step 1: start step 2: declare array and left, right, mid variable step 3: perform merge function. if left > right return mid= (left+right)/2 mergesort (array, left, … Web4 jan. 2024 · Like merge sort in C, quick sorting in C also follows the principle of decrease and conquer — or, as it is often called, divide and conquer. The quicksort algorithm is a sorting algorithm that works by selecting a pivot point, and thereafter partitioning the number set, or array, around the pivot point.

Web27 jan. 2015 · Alternative solution with part parameters 0 to size of array. My old C compiler doesn't support variable sized arrays so I used _alloca () as a substitute. Other …

Web7 apr. 2024 · The difference between these two algorithms is with handling values from both input ranges which compare equivalent (see notes on LessThanComparable ). If … ign efootballWebMerge Sort Algorithm. Merge sort is another sorting technique and has an algorithm that has a reasonably proficient space-time complexity - O (n log n) and is quite trivial to … ignea youtubeWeb14 apr. 2024 · Merge Sort is a popular sorting algorithm that works by dividing an array into smaller arrays until each sub-array contains only one element, and then merging those sub-arrays in a sorted order until the entire array is sorted. Here is an example implementation of Merge Sort in C#: igneo holdings financial statementsWebSequential merge sort algorithm: MergeSort (arr [], l, r) Parallel Merge Sort algorithm. Approach 1: Quick Merge sort. Approach 2: Odd-Even merge sort. Approach 3: Bitonic merge sort. Approach 4: Parallel merge sort with load balancing. Prerequisite: Merge Sort Algorithm. Let us get started with Parallel Merge Sort. is the area you see through the microscopeWebWorking of the Merge Sort Algorithm. Let take an example to understand the working of the merge sort algorithm –. The given array is [ 11, 6, 3, 24, 46, 22, 7 ], an array is subdivided into several sub-arrays in this method. Each sub-array is solved separately. The merge sort divides the entire array into two equal parts iteratively until the ... igneo spanishWebProgram Output: If arrays are not sorted so you can sort them first and then use the above merge function, another method is to merge them and then sort the array. Two small … igneol shinyWebIt's the combine step, where you have to merge two sorted subarrays, where the real work happens. In the next challenge, you'll focus on implementing the overall merge sort … igneo in english